Sharp Stars Receives Poets Prize Nomination

Congratulations to BOA poet Sharon Bryan for having her collection Sharp Stars nominated for the distinguished Poet's Prize. The Poet's Prize is awarded by a panel of fellow poets in honor of the "best book of poems published in 2009." This isn't the first award recognition for Sharp Stars either. The book was given the Isabella Gardner Poetry Award for 2009. The Gardner Award is given biennially to a poet in mid-career whose manuscript is of exceptional merit.  Adam Zagajewski says of the book: "Sharon Bryan is a poet who contemplates radical questions and situations.  Her beautiful astonishment vis-a-vis the universe knows...

[caption id="attachment_1111" align="aligncenter" width="203" caption="White Hand Society by BOA's Publisher Peter Conners"][/caption] Peter Conners is not only BOA's Publisher, but he's also an author in his own right! His latest book, White Hand Society: The Psychedelic Partnership of Timothy Leary & Allen Ginsberg, weaves a fascinating and entertaining tale of the life, times and friendship of these two larger-than-life counterculture figures and the incredible impact their relationship had on America. Dougherty & Harrington Poetry Workshop for Kids

Thanks to everyone who came out last Saturday to make Dine & Rhyme a huge success! Over the next week or two we'll post pictures from the reading, the reception, and all the surrounding hooplah. For now, we want to share some pics from a portion of the Dine & Rhyme that most people didn't get to see. As part of this year's event, we partnered with Nazareth College and the Rochester Literacy Movement to offer writing workshops to underserved area youths. Accompanied by their Rochester Literacy Movement mentors, the kids came to Nazareth where they participated in small group...
